John R. Cook, 69, of New Carlisle, IN, passed away unexpectedly on Monday March 30, 2026 in his home. He was born on May 23, 1956, in Indianapolis, IN, to the late Joseph, Sr. and Barbara (Stalcup) Cook. He was also preceded in death by a brother, James Cook. On March 18, 1989, he married Sonia Thomas, who survives, also surviving are his son, Jarrod Cook of LaPorte, two grandchildren, Damon and Ayla Cook, a brother, Joseph Cook, Jr, his aunt Nancy, uncle Don Claus and numerous cousins, nephews and a niece. Mr. Cook worked as a Hydraulic Manifold Designer for Daman Products in Mishawaka. He was a lead guitarist for many years in the 70's and 80's. Music was his passion, as he also wrote and produced his own music up until a few years ago. His greatest love was his son and wife and so much more when his grandchildren were born.
There will be no visitation, cremation will take place. A Celebration of Life for John will be held at a later date.
